		<title>How can I post a gallery in WordPress that is password protected?</title>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>There are a few steps to take, but it&#8217;s quick and painless.</p>
<ul>
<li>Make sure you are on WP 3.0 or above</li>
<li>Create a new page, let&#8217;s call it &#8216;Secure&#8217; for now (other names may be proofs, comps, etc.)</li>
<li>Create another page for the gallery you want to password protect</li>
<li>On this page take care of several things
<ul>
<li>The title of your post (at top)</li>
<li>Under &#8220;Publish&#8221; at right, go to &#8216;Visibility&#8221; and hit &#8220;edit&#8221; and click on &#8220;Password protected&#8221; and enter the password you want to use, then &#8220;OK&#8221;</li>
<li>Under &#8220;Page Attributions&#8221; in the &#8220;Parent&#8221; drop down, choose &#8220;Secure&#8221; (or whatever page you created above.</li>
<li>Back under &#8220;Publish&#8221; click &#8220;Save Draft&#8221;</li>
</ul>
</li>
</ul>
<p>Now it&#8217;s time to load the gallery.</p>
<p>Above, next to &#8220;Upload/Insert&#8221; there is a small square within a square image (or &#8220;Add an Image&#8221; button). Click it. You will be taken to an upload page for your images.</p>
<p>Once you go through selecting all the images, click &#8220;Save all changes.&#8221;</p>
<p>Go BACK to the &#8220;Add an Image&#8221; button and it will show you a &#8220;Gallery&#8221; option. I recommend two images across.</p>
<p>Once you hit &#8220;Save&#8221; all you have to do is go test it out.</p>
<p>NOTE: Once you&#8217;ve entered the password, you will always have access to that page.</p>
